We signed up to be at the Special Olympics today! Grammy sent me a bracelet for down syndrome support and a button that had her grandson Nash and his dog Seger on it so they could be with us in spirit. THe weather held out no rain YAY and it was cool enough to make it just about perfect for an athletic event.


I was with two other dogs and their owners stationed at Victory Garden. Victor did very well. He even sang his songs a couple of times, caught bubbles and did some tricks. At one point three teenagers leaned down their faces no more then an inch apart from each other and very upclose and personal in Victor's face. All he did was wag his tail and hold very still. Another time people crowded in around him, 5 or six all petting him at the same time, some kneeling, some standing. He gave good eye contact, the one thing that i think makes him a really good therapy dog. He got to greet about a hundred kids and he wished them all good luck. ONly one time did i see him be a bit nervous and that was when a very hyper 2-3 year old starting jumping around him. He quickly moved behind me and that was ok too. My grandaughter helped me by carrying my drink and Victor's bucket that had my camera in it. THen she went over to watch the races and made some friends. When the lady came that was suppose to relieve us found out her dog was terrified of the starter gun, she had to leave so we stayed another half hour until the next dogs arrived to take our place. SO he did an extra shift too. Towards the end he stopped looking at people when they approached him, you can tell when the dogs have had enough and i knew it was time for us to go. I bought him a hamburger on the way home. He made me very proud.
